This commit is contained in:
paoloar77
2024-05-20 00:31:52 +02:00
parent ae36a4a2c1
commit 03fa01a1bb

View File

@@ -6122,12 +6122,6 @@ Route::get('/aggiornapreorder/{idarticolo}/{aggiornapreordine}', function ($idar
echo "Variazioni: " . $product['parent_id'] . "<br>"; echo "Variazioni: " . $product['parent_id'] . "<br>";
$variations = Variation::all($product['parent_id']); $variations = Variation::all($product['parent_id']);
showarray($variations); showarray($variations);
foreach ($variations as $variation) {
if ($variation->id == $product['id']) {
$variation->save();
break;
}
}
for ($i = 0; $i < count($variations); $i++) { for ($i = 0; $i < count($variations); $i++) {
$variation = $variations[$i]; $variation = $variations[$i];
if ($variation->id == $product['id']) { if ($variation->id == $product['id']) {
@@ -6137,13 +6131,12 @@ Route::get('/aggiornapreorder/{idarticolo}/{aggiornapreordine}', function ($idar
} }
} }
$old = false; echo "Data:";
showarray($data);
if ($old) { $agg = false;
echo "Data:"; $data['meta_data'] = $product['meta_data'];
showarray($data); if ($agg) {
$data['meta_data'] = $product['meta_data'];
updateValueByKey($data['meta_data'], $campoPreOrder, 'yes'); updateValueByKey($data['meta_data'], $campoPreOrder, 'yes');
updateValueByKey($data['meta_data'], '_is_pre_order', 'yes'); updateValueByKey($data['meta_data'], '_is_pre_order', 'yes');
updateValueByKey($data['meta_data'], '_pre_order_date', $datenow); updateValueByKey($data['meta_data'], '_pre_order_date', $datenow);
@@ -6157,12 +6150,12 @@ Route::get('/aggiornapreorder/{idarticolo}/{aggiornapreordine}', function ($idar
updateValueByKey($data['meta_data'], '_wpro_date_variable', ''); updateValueByKey($data['meta_data'], '_wpro_date_variable', '');
updateValueByKey($data['meta_data'], '_wpro_time_variable', ''); updateValueByKey($data['meta_data'], '_wpro_time_variable', '');
updateValueByKey($data['meta_data'], '_rank_math_gtin_code', ''); updateValueByKey($data['meta_data'], '_rank_math_gtin_code', '');
echo "<br>Dati da Salvare:";
showarray($data);
$variation = Variation::update($idprodotto, $product['id'], $data);
} }
echo "<br>Dati da Salvare:";
showarray($data);
$variation = Variation::update($idprodotto, $product['id'], $data);
// Product::update($idprodotto, $data); // Product::update($idprodotto, $data);
if ($variation) { if ($variation) {
echo "Aggiornato Preorder: [ParentId=" . $idprodotto . '] ProdId= ' . $product['id'] . ' ' . $variation['name'] . "<br>"; echo "Aggiornato Preorder: [ParentId=" . $idprodotto . '] ProdId= ' . $product['id'] . ' ' . $variation['name'] . "<br>";